Embodiment 1

[0043] see figure 1 , figure 1 It is a schematic structural diagram of a constant current driver for an LED light source disclosed in Embodiment 1 of the present invention. The constant current driver is arranged between the power supply 200 and the LED light source 300, and includes a plurality of parallel power supply circuits 1-N, and each power supply circuit includes a current processing unit and a separation circuit.

[0044] Wherein, the current processing unit is used to supply constant current to the LED light source, and at least one constant current module is included in the current processing unit; An on-off device, and / or an on-off device connected between the LED light source 300 and the output terminal of the constant current module in the power supply circuit to which it belongs. Abstract

The invention discloses a constant current driver of an LED (light emitting diode) light source, which comprises a plurality of power supply loops connected in parallel, wherein each power supply loop comprises a current processing unit and a separation circuit; the current processing unit comprises a constant current module which is used for supplying constant current power to the LED light source; and the separation circuit comprises on-off devices connected between a power supply and the input end of the current processing unit in the power supply loop of the power supply and / or on-off devices connected between the output end of the constant current module in the power supply loop of the power supply and the LED light source. According to the constant current driver disclosed by the invention, when one or more power supply loops have faults, the power supply loops are separated from the rest power supply loops under the action of the separation circuits inside the power supply loops having faults, and the rest power supply loops continuously supply power to the LED light source, so that the LED light source can not be switched off due to the faults of some power supply loops, thereby improving the stability and reliability of the constant current driver. The invention also discloses an LED lamp.

technical field [0001] The invention relates to the technical field of power supply for LED light sources, in particular to a constant current driver for LED light sources and an LED lamp. Background technique [0002] LED light sources are used in more and more occasions due to their advantages of long life, high luminous efficiency, and environmental protection. The life of the LED light source itself is as long as 50,000 hours, and the LED lamp is mainly caused by the failure of the driver of the LED light source. Among the reasons for the failure of the driver of the LED light source, the failure of each semiconductor device is the most prominent. The main reason for the failure is that the LED light source itself heats up seriously. The LED driver is usually placed inside the lamp, close to the LED light source, and the high temperature working environment is harmful to The operating characteristics of semiconductor devices are greatly affected.
